Photo etching, also known as chemical machining or photochemical milling, is a process that uses chemicals to selectively remove material from a metal sheet to create intricate and precise components. This method offers a level of precision that is difficult to achieve with traditional mechanical cutting methods.

The process begins with a photoresist material being applied to the metal sheet. A photographic film with the desired pattern is then placed on top of the photoresist, and the sheet is exposed to ultraviolet light. The areas of the photoresist that are exposed to light harden, while the areas covered by the pattern remain soft.

Next, the sheet is submerged in an etchant solution, which selectively removes the soft photoresist to expose the underlying metal. The etchant then eats away at the unprotected metal, leaving behind the desired pattern. The result is a highly accurate and detailed component that meets the exact specifications provided.

One of the major advantages of photo etching service is its ability to produce intricate and complex parts with tight tolerances. This process can create components with feature sizes as small as 0.003 inches, making it ideal for applications that require high precision.

Another significant benefit of photo etching is its versatility. This method can be used to work with a wide range of metals, including stainless steel, copper, aluminum, and more. It can also be used on thin and delicate materials without causing any distortion or burring, which is often a problem with traditional machining methods.

Furthermore, photo etching is a cost-effective solution for producing small to medium-sized batches of components. Since the process is highly automated and does not require specialized tooling, it can be more economical than traditional machining methods for low-volume production runs.

The applications of photo etching service are vast and varied. In the electronics industry, this process is commonly used to manufacture intricate circuit boards, connectors, and shielding components. In the aerospace sector, photo etching is utilized to produce lightweight and high-strength parts for aircraft and spacecraft.

In the medical field, photo etching is employed to create surgical instruments, implants, and other precision components that require precise dimensions and exceptional quality. The automotive industry also benefits from photo etching service, using it to manufacture gears, springs, and other critical components for vehicles.
